Title : In vitro plant regeneration of large Cardamom (Amomum subulatum Rox.) Material Type: printed text Authors: A.K Chaudhary, Author ; Paudyal, K.P., Author ; B. Chalise, Author ; Khatiwada, P.P., Author ; Ghimire, K., Author Pagination: 259-263 p. Languages : English (eng) Keywords: Amomum subulatum, in vitro regeneration, large cardamom Abstract: In vitro plant regeneration techniques are used for large scale production of disease free plant materials. Laboratory experiments were conducted for two consecutive years (2005/2006 to 2006/2007) in National Citrus Research Program, Paripatle to develop a complete protocol for in vitro plant regeneration of large cardamom. For in vitro proliferation, the stem explants were tested in MS medium (1962) supplemented with three different levels of NAA and five levels of BAP in a completely randomized design with seven replications……………….

Title : Embryo culture for interspecific hybridization in the Genus Oryza: A simplified technique of hardening improves the field plant establishment Material Type: printed text Authors: Niroula, R.K., Author ; L.P Subedi, Author ; Sharma, R.C., Author ; M.P Upadhyay, Author Pagination: 147-152p. Languages : English (eng) Keywords: Embryo culture hardening techniques, media composition, regeneration, wild species Abstract: Embryo culture is an efficient plant breeding tool to accomplish wide hybridization in the genus Oryza. Successful plant regeneration from embryo culture is affected by several factors such as age of embryo, medium composition, light hours, temperature and humidity during culture and technique of hardening. Six hybrids (Kalanamak/O.nivara, Kalanamak/O. rufipogon, Kalanamak/O. officinalis, Manshara/O. officinalis, IR 64/O.nivara, and IR 72/O. granulate), two improved parents viz IR72 and O. granulata were subjected to five different media and four techniques of hardening to determine the efficiency of these media for germination and techniques for seedlings hardening………
